Back Market operates a leading global marketplace for refurbished electronics, connecting consumers with vetted professional refurbishers across smartphones, laptops, tablets, and other devices. Founded in 2014 and headquartered in Paris, the company has established itself as a dominant player in the circular economy space, offering quality-assured pre-owned electronics with warranties and return policies. The platform has achieved significant scale, reaching a $5.7 billion valuation while expanding across multiple international markets. Back Market continues to focus on accelerating the adoption of refurbished electronics as a mainstream alternative to new devices, capitalizing on growing consumer environmental consciousness and cost-sensitivity trends.
